What is a Flat Rack FCL Sailing Schedule for Machinery from China to Europe?
A Flat Rack FCL sailing schedule for machinery from China to Europe represents the planned departures and arrivals of vessels carrying specialized containers. These containers lack side walls and roofs, which makes them perfect for oversized industrial equipment and heavy vehicles. Moreover, the schedule accounts for the unique handling requirements that out-of-gauge cargo demands during loading and unloading operations.
Choosing sea freight for machinery transport allows businesses to move massive components that would not fit in standard dry vans. Therefore, shippers must align their production timelines with these specific vessel rotations to minimize storage fees at the port. Additionally, the frequency of these sailings varies depending on the carrier and the specific Chinese port of origin.

How Does Flat Rack FCL Compare to Other Shipping Options?
When evaluating the Flat Rack FCL sailing schedule for machinery from China to Europe, it is vital to consider alternatives like Ro-Ro or Breakbulk. While flat racks offer the convenience of being part of a standard container ship’s manifest, Ro-Ro is often better for drivable machinery. On the other hand, rail freight provides a faster middle-ground for certain dimensions.
To illustrate the differences, we have compiled a comparison of the primary methods used for machinery transport. Each option has specific trade-offs regarding cost, speed, and safety. Accordingly, you should select the method that best fits your cargo’s physical dimensions and your budget constraints.
| Shipping Method | Cost Range | Transit Time | Best For | Limitations |
|---|---|---|---|---|
| Flat Rack FCL | $3,500 – $5,500 | 30-40 Days | Oversized Static Cargo | Height/Width Limits |
| Ro-Ro | $4,000 – $7,000 | 35-45 Days | Self-Propelled Units | Limited Port Access |
| Rail Freight | $6,000 – $9,000 | 18-22 Days | Urgent Mid-Size Gear | Strict Weight Limits |
| Breakbulk | Variable | 40-50 Days | Extremely Large Items | Infrequent Schedule |

Key Ports and Transit Times in the 2025 Sailing Schedule
Major Chinese hubs like Shanghai, Ningbo, and Shenzhen offer the most frequent sailings for flat rack containers. For example, the Flat Rack FCL sailing schedule for machinery from China to Europe typically features direct calls to Rotterdam, Hamburg, and Antwerp. Meanwhile, secondary ports might require transshipment through Singapore, adding roughly seven days to the total journey.
As of early 2025, transit times have stabilized despite earlier disruptions in the Red Sea region. Most carriers are now utilizing the Cape of Good Hope route, which has extended the average transit time by approximately 10 to 14 days. Nevertheless, the reliability of these schedules remains high for those who book at least three weeks in advance.
Common Transit Time Estimates
Shanghai to Rotterdam: 35 to 42 days via major carriers like COSCO or Maersk. Shenzhen to Hamburg: 32 to 38 days depending on the specific vessel rotation. Ningbo to Felixstowe: 38 to 45 days including potential UK port congestion delays.

Understanding the Costs of Flat Rack Machinery Shipping
Shipping costs for flat racks are significantly higher than standard 40HQ containers due to the lost slots on the vessel. Specifically, when cargo exceeds the width or height of the container frame, it prevents other containers from being stacked around it. Consequently, carriers charge ‘lost slot’ fees to compensate for the unused space on the ship.
In the current market for Q1 2025, a 40ft Flat Rack from China to Northern Europe ranges between $4,000 and $6,500. Moreover, you must factor in lashing and securing costs, which are vital for preventing damage during transit. Without a doubt, professional lashing is a non-negotiable expense for heavy machinery transport.
Case Studies: Successful Machinery Shipments in 2024-2025
Examining real-world examples helps clarify the process of managing a Flat Rack FCL sailing schedule for machinery from China to Europe. These cases highlight the importance of planning and the typical costs involved in modern logistics. Below are two scenarios involving different types of industrial equipment.
Case Study 1: Shanghai to Hamburg. Cargo: CNC Milling Machine, 18 CBM, 12,000 kg. Container: 40ft Flat Rack. Shipping Details: Carrier: COSCO. Port of Loading: Shanghai. Port of Discharge: Hamburg. Route: Direct. Cost Breakdown: Ocean Freight: $4,200. Origin Charges: $450. Destination Charges: $600. Customs: $200. Total Landed Cost: $5,450. Timeline: Booking to Loading: 5 days. Sea Transit: 38 days. Customs: 2 days. Total Door-to-Door: 45 days. Key Insight: Early booking secured a slot during the pre-CNY rush.
Case Study 2: Shenzhen to Felixstowe. Cargo: Construction Excavator, 25 CBM, 15,500 kg. Container: 40ft Flat Rack (Over-width). Shipping Details: Carrier: MSC. Port of Loading: Shenzhen. Port of Discharge: Felixstowe. Route: Transshipment via Singapore. Cost Breakdown: Ocean Freight: $5,100. Origin Charges: $550. Destination Charges: $750. Customs: $300. Total Landed Cost: $6,700. Timeline: Booking to Loading: 7 days. Sea Transit: 42 days. Customs: 3 days. Total Door-to-Door: 52 days. Key Insight: Using a transshipment route saved $800 compared to the direct service.
Customs Brokerage and Documentation for Machinery
Navigating the legal requirements is just as important as the physical transport of the goods. Therefore, securing a reliable customs brokerage service ensures that your machinery meets all European import standards. For instance, you will need a detailed packing list, a commercial invoice, and often a technical data sheet for the machinery.
Furthermore, many European countries require specific certifications like the CE mark for industrial equipment. If these documents are missing, the cargo may be detained at the port of discharge, leading to heavy demurrage fees. Accordingly, it is wise to prepare all paperwork at least two weeks before the vessel arrives.

Which Option Should You Choose for Your Machinery?
The decision between various shipping methods depends on your specific priorities regarding speed, safety, and cost. If your budget is the main priority, then the Flat Rack FCL sailing schedule for machinery from China to Europe remains the most balanced choice. However, if speed is the absolute priority, you might consider a door to door rail solution.
Volume thresholds also play a role in your decision-making process. For shipments exceeding 50 tons, breakbulk vessels often become more economical than multiple flat racks. Meanwhile, for smaller components that fit in a standard box, regular FCL is always the cheaper route. To summarize, analyze your cargo’s dimensions carefully before committing to a specific container type.
